    Moozone.com online music storage. Moozone for Android lets users upload manage and stream their music. However its not just another streaming application. It does a few things differently. First of all it is possible to save tracks or playlists into a Save Box to play them later offline. It is a great feature if you spend a lot of time in the areas of low or no reception (a subway train might be a good example). Second of all it lets users upload their music directly from android phones to moozone storage. It might be useful for new users who have just installed the app and want to backup all the old music they have in their phone right away. Of course 3G upstream speeds are not that great but theres always a WiFi option. And finally streaming itself has been designed to improve reliability. You can actually enjoy your music uninterruptedly while moving around. Moozone is a free app and it comes with 2GB of free storage. Additional storage can be purchased at a price of approximately $1 per gigabyte.
